Moga return date revealed

Nathan Brown has Tautau Moga earmarked for a Round 1 return from injury.

The nib Newcastle Knights centre has been sidelined with an ACL injury suffered in the early rounds of the 2018 season.

With Moga almost back to full training, Brown has revealed he expects the 25-year-old to play the opening round of the season in the ISP NSW competition.

“Tau got some really good news the other day,” Brown said.

“He’s going to start doing a little bit more stuff with the team. (We’re) not expecting Tau to play until Round 1.

“That day, he’ll probably look to play half an hour in reserve grade.”

The Club is sitting nicely when it comes to the injury list.

Slade Griffin is still a long-term prospect as he recovers from an ACL injury but Jacob Saifiti is on the comeback trail from an ankle injury.

The prop started running last week after having surgery on his lower leg and according to Brown, like Moga, will push to get back for the opening round.

“Jakey is tracking along really well,” he said.

“He’s a fair way ahead of where we thought he would be.

“Hopefully he gets himself back in fulltime (training) soon. I don’t think he’ll be right for trials. He’s a bit like Tau, he’s going to be right for possibly Round 1.”
